Roof maintenance on Millburn estates is not an optional expense -- it is the stewardship obligation that preserves the architectural investment these properties represent. A slate roof installed on a Wyoming Historic District home in 1928 has survived ninety-eight years because someone maintained it: replacing cracked slates before water reached the deck, re-soldering copper flashings before joints opened, clearing debris from valleys before organic acids attacked the stone surface. That maintenance discipline is what separates the Millburn slate roofs that will see their hundredth anniversary from those that were replaced decades ago because deferred maintenance allowed recoverable conditions to become irreversible failures.
The multi-structure complexity of Short Hills estates makes systematic maintenance essential. A property with four roofed structures -- main residence, guest house, pool pavilion, detached garage -- presents four independent roofing systems aging at different rates under different exposure conditions. Without a structured maintenance program, the pool pavilion's flat membrane receives attention only when it leaks, by which time the substrate damage has multiplied the repair cost tenfold. Our estate maintenance programs inspect and service every structure on the property at scheduled intervals, preventing the selective neglect that occurs when homeowners focus on the main residence and overlook auxiliary buildings until emergency conditions force attention.
Seasonal timing drives the maintenance calendar for Millburn's diverse roofing systems. Spring inspections address winter damage -- ice dam residue, freeze-thaw displacement of slate and tile, gutter damage from ice loading. Fall preparation includes debris clearing from valleys and gutters before leaf drop accelerates, flashing inspection before winter precipitation tests every seal, and ventilation verification before cold weather makes attic access uncomfortable. Insurance carriers serving Millburn's high-value residential market increasingly reward documented maintenance history with favorable terms. Carriers like Chubb and PURE evaluate maintenance posture as an underwriting factor -- a property with annual professional maintenance records signals lower risk than an identical property with no maintenance documentation. Local Challenges in Millburn




The diversity of roofing materials across a Millburn estate demands maintenance crews with cross-material expertise that standard roofing maintenance companies rarely possess. Slate maintenance requires different tools, techniques, and replacement materials than copper flashing service, which differs entirely from flat membrane inspection and repair. A maintenance crew visiting a Short Hills estate might need to clear debris from slate valleys using soft-bristle tools that won't scratch stone surfaces, re-solder a copper hip flashing using torch equipment, clean moss from cedar shake sections with low-pressure treatment, and inspect TPO seams on the kitchen addition -- four distinct material specialties in a single service visit. Landscape integration on Millburn estates creates maintenance conditions that compound roofing system wear. Mature specimen trees depositing needles, leaves, seed pods, and small branches onto roof surfaces accelerate debris accumulation in valleys and behind dormers. Climbing hydrangea and English ivy -- prized for their architectural effect on Millburn homes -- can penetrate flashing edges and lift slate coursing if not monitored and trimmed during maintenance visits. Each Millburn maintenance program begins with a comprehensive baseline assessment of every roofing system on the property. This initial evaluation establishes the material inventory, documents current conditions with photography, identifies deferred maintenance items requiring immediate attention, and creates the customized maintenance protocol that will govern subsequent scheduled visits. The baseline becomes the reference document against which future inspections measure condition changes, allowing us to identify deterioration trends before they produce failures.

Scheduled maintenance visits follow the protocol established during baseline assessment, with seasonal adjustments appropriate to each material. Spring visits focus on winter damage assessment and remediation. Fall visits emphasize pre-winter preparation: debris clearing, flashing integrity verification, gutter function testing, and ventilation confirmation. Each visit produces a service report documenting observations, work performed, and any conditions requiring monitoring or escalation to repair status.
